WebMar 1, 2024 · @article{Liu2024ElectrochemicallyID, title={Electrochemically induced dilute gold-in-nickel nanoalloy as a highly robust electrocatalyst for alkaline hydrogen oxidation reaction}, author={Jing Liu and Boyang Zhang and Yumeng Fo and Wanqing Yu and Jie Ying Gao and Xuejing Cui and Xin Zhou and Luhua Jiang}, journal={Chemical … WebDec 24, 2024 · Inorganic electron donors include hydrogen, carbon monoxide, ammonia, nitrite, sulfur, sulfide, and ferrous iron. Lithotrophs have been found growing in rock formations thousands of meters below the surface of Earth. Because of their volume of distribution, lithotrophs may actually out number organotrophs and phototrophs in our …

Web2. All monoatomic ions have the same oxidation number as the charge on the ion. e.g. Mg 2+ has the oxidation number of +2. 3. All combined hydrogen has an oxidation number of +1 (except metal hydrides where its oxidation number is -1). 4. All combined oxygen has an oxidation number of -2 (except peroxides where the oxidation number is -1). 5.
